Output 66ea4656b3d453d635f1c0967c05c7ea3d5d8448c3c33c764230bade0afa6648:0

value
486996756
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1bdf4ca03d9780fd9b814fe89f2900f3af1c62bf OP_EQUALVERIFY OP_CHECKSIG
address
13YNkHiS57xbd7GNtkm4E697cRG6EbnRR3
transaction
66ea4656b3d453d635f1c0967c05c7ea3d5d8448c3c33c764230bade0afa6648
spent
true